With that in mind, this manual defines program evaluation as “the systematic collection of information about the activities, characteristics, and outcomes of programs to make judgments about the program, improve program effectiveness, and/or inform decisions about future program development.”The Kirkpatrick Model of Evaluation, first developed by Donald Kirkpatrick in 1959, is the most popular model for evaluating the effectiveness of a training program. The model includes four levels of evaluation, and as such, is sometimes referred to as 'Kirkpatrick's levels" or the "four levels." Oct 20, 2023 · Evaluation. Recognizes the interests of program leaders or other stakeholders in the design of the inquiry. Judges merit or worth. Informs decision-making related to the program. Lacks a controlled setting. Research. Involves intellectual curiosity in a design that includes hypothesis or theory of change testing. Process Evaluation determines whether program activities have been implemented as intended and resulted in certain outputs.
